Queen Elizabeth Country Park — South Downs, Hampshire
This national park provides a mix of woodland and open downland, ideal for walking and mountain biking. High points like Butser Hill reward with panoramic views across the rolling hills of Hampshire. Mendip Activity Centre — Somerset
The Mendip Hills provide a playground for climbing, abseiling, kayaking, paddleboarding, archery, and more. We can coordinate private instruction and exclusive time slots, ensuring that your outdoor adventure feels curated and uninterrupted.

Air and Aerial Experiences
Hot Air Ballooning and Aerial Pursuits
Hot air ballooning remains one of the most memorable ways to experience southern England. Launches over Bath, Wiltshire, or the Marlborough Downs offer views of the countryside, rivers, and towns from dawn light to sunset. Outside of the annual Bristol Balloon Fiesta, our team can arrange bespoke balloon flights across the region. Paragliding, hang gliding, and skydiving experiences can also be incorporated, creating unforgettable perspectives of the landscape.
